Judy Lee Hall
0
SHARES
336
VIEWS
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Please note that this post contains affiliate links and any sales made through such links will reward MageeNews.com a small commission – at no extra cost to you.

Judy Lee Hall passed away on Sunday, December 14, 2025, surrounded by her loving family. She was born on September 27, 1953, to James Pierce and Lois Overstreet Pierce in Pascagoula, MS.
Judy loved her family and enjoyed being with them. She wanted their gatherings, especially with her grandchildren. She was a wonderful daughter, mother, grandmother, and sister.
She was preceded in death by her parents, James and Lois Pierce; her husband, Jimmy Don Hall; her second husband, Lee Ray Hall; her brothers, Jimmy Pierce and Michael Pierce; and her grandchild, Shane Weston Hines.
Judy is survived by her sons, Jimmy C. Hall (Tina), James A. Hall (Teia), Brandon H. Hall (Sonya); daughter, Carrie Lee Hall (Wade); four sisters, nineteen grandchildren, and eight great-grandchildren.
Funeral services will be held on Wednesday, December 17, 2025, at Calvary Baptist Church at 2:00 PM with Bro. Leban Blakeney officiating the service. Visitation will begin at 11:00 AM and continue until 2:00 PM. Interment will follow in Calvary Cemetery.
Pallbearers are Justin Hynes, Lane Hall, Thomas Hall, Tristan Hopkins, Logan Hopkins, and Colton Hall. Honorary pallbearers are Christopher Watford, Jon Meadows, Hunter Meadows, Justin Meadows, Landon Hall, and William Watford.

Arrangements are entrusted to Tutor Funeral Home.
